About this home

Crescent City

Nestled along the shores of Crescent Lake, (15,900 acres) this stunning lakefront home combines a rare blend of comfort, elegance, and natural beauty. The impeccably maintained 2-bedroom, 2-bath home sits gracefully at the water's edge, where each sunrise paints the sky in breathtaking hues, best enjoyed from the spacious screened porch. Inside, refined details such as crown molding, a wood-burning fireplace, and open concept creating an atmosphere of warmth and sophistication. Set on a quiet dead-end street, the property spans approx. 0.72 acres of fully fenced, gated land adorned with mature trees and 110 feet of pristine lake frontage. The bulkheaded shoreline leads to a private dock equipped with water, electricity, and a covered boat house with lift--perfect for launching adventures across Dunns Creek & the St. Johns River to the Atlantic Ocean. Whether savoring tranquil mornings or setting out for a day on the water, this lakeside haven captures the essence of Florida living.

  • • Homeowners insurance is on top — in Florida it varies widely with roof age and wind/flood zone (see the Reality Check below). Budget it before you offer.
  • • In CDD communities (Nocatee, eTown, Seven Pines…), bond assessments are collected on the property-tax bill, and the amount varies home to home — a prior owner may have prepaid the bond — so we confirm this home’s exact line rather than trust a community average.
  • • Taxes are estimated at YOUR purchase price — Florida assessments reset on sale, so the seller’s current bill is usually lower than yours will be (that applies to the reference bill above too).

Taxes & assessment

2025 property taxes (current owner): $4,696/yr

Florida’s Save Our Homes cap limits how fast the current owner’s assessment can rise — and it resets when a home sells, so a buyer’s tax bill is typically based on the purchase price, not the seller’s bill above. Sources: Florida DOR certified tax roll, NEFMLS.

Storms & insurance

Florida Reality Check

The storm-and-insurance facts every Florida buyer should know up front.

Zone X — minimal flood hazard

Flood insurance is typically not required by lenders (always optional).

Flood damage is not covered by standard homeowners insurance — it’s always a separate policy.

Hurricane evacuation zone C

Zone C evacuates after zones A, B in an approaching storm.

Roof: Shingle — year not disclosed (home built 2019)

Roof age drives Florida insurance pricing more than anything else — worth confirming before you offer.

Septic system (public record) · Private well (public record)

County records indicate an onsite septic system — budget a septic inspection before closing (typically $300–$500) and expect pump-outs every 3–5 years.
